PZU15B2,115 by Nexperia

Overview of PZU15B2,115 by Nexperia.

The PZU15B2,115 by Nexperia is classified within the electronic components subcategory of Zener Diodes, known for maintaining stable voltage levels within circuit applications. This component specifically features a nominal Zener voltage of 15V and can handle a power dissipation of up to 310 mW. Packaged in a small outline SOD323F, a plastic SC-90 with two pins, it is designed for surface mount technology, making it suitable for high-density PCB installations.

The diode is constructed from silicon, utilizing Zener technology to provide excellent voltage regulation. Key attributes include a maximum operating temperature of 150 °C and a minimum of -65 °C, reflecting its robustness in diverse environmental conditions. Additionally, it adheres to several important industry standards such as AEC-Q101 and IEC-60134, ensuring reliability and performance under automotive and safety critical applications. Its compliance with RoHS and REACH also stands out, ensuring it meets current environmental and health standards globally.
